Achieving magnet redesignation: a framework for cultural change
Valda V Upenieks1, Mary Sitterding
1Upenieks Health Services Consulting, West Hills, California 91304, USA. valda@upeniekshealthservicesconsulting.com
Abstract:
Magnet recognition is the highest award that the ANCC bestows on an institution and exemplifies a hospital's accomplishments in providing commitment, support, and resources for nursing excellence throughout the organization. Magnet hospitals attain their status based on structure and outcome criteria known as the 14 Forces of Magnetism. The authors discuss one hospital's journey and the outstanding models integrated in their organization that paved the way for their first award, followed by their journey toward redesignation.
